Growing requirements
Eucalyptus amygdalina, commonly known as the black peppermint, is a member of the Myrtaceae family native to Tasmania. This species is highly valued for its aromatic foliage and robust timber characteristics.
The plant thrives in temperate climates with moderate rainfall. It requires well-drained, slightly acidic soils to reach its full growth potential and avoid root system complications.
Adequate sunlight is a primary requirement for the healthy development of this tree. It should be planted in areas where canopy competition is minimal, allowing for optimal photosynthesis.
Agricultural management includes regular soil testing to ensure the presence of vital nutrients. While hardy, the species benefits from consistent moisture levels during the initial establishment phase.
The tree shows a high tolerance for varying terrain, including rocky slopes. Proper spacing is essential to encourage straight trunk formation, which increases the commercial value of the timber.
Yield
The wood harvested from Eucalyptus amygdalina is widely utilized in the construction industry due to its durability. It serves as a reliable material for flooring and structural framing.
The foliage is an excellent source of essential oils, particularly cineole-rich compounds. These extracts are fundamental in the production of pharmaceutical, cosmetic, and cleaning products.
This species is frequently used in land reclamation projects. Its ability to absorb high volumes of groundwater effectively assists in managing swampy or waterlogged agricultural lands.
Fast-growing cycles provide a reliable turnover for biomass production. Forestry operations utilize short-rotation logging to sustain constant supply chains for industrial demand.
The plantation contributes to local biodiversity when managed sustainably. Its role in carbon sequestration makes it an increasingly important crop in modern agroforestry programs.
Main diseases and pests
Pests such as eucalyptus weevils represent a significant threat to leaf health. These insects can cause widespread defoliation if left untreated by professional pest management.
Root rot caused by various soil-borne fungi remains a major risk in waterlogged areas. Maintaining drainage systems is critical for preventing plant mortality.
Fire hazards are exceptionally high in eucalyptus stands due to the volatile oils present in the tree. Firebreaks and preventative clearing are necessary for plantation safety.
Browsing mammals can cause physical damage to young saplings, impeding growth. Protective mesh or fencing is often required during the early stages of plantation development.
Environmental stress, such as frost or prolonged drought, may weaken the tree's immunity. Careful selection of site and climate-appropriate varieties is key to a successful harvest.
